The 34th match of the T20 World Cup tournament is scheduled to take place on 2nd November at Adelaide Oval. And this face-off will be taking place between the winner of ‘Group B’ (Zimbabwe) and runner-up of ‘Group A’ (Netherlands). 

Team of Zimbabwe

Overall, the Zimbabwe team has encountered three matches of the tournament. But till now, they managed to register only one victory as one of the matches was washed out by rain, and they were defeated in the other match. They successfully defeated Pakistan but couldn’t retain their form in the face-off against Bangladesh. According to reports, their bowling options leaked 150 runs in 20 overs. Among the bowlers, Richard Ngarava showed up as the most successful one. He was followed by Blessing Muzarabani, Sikandar Raza and Sean Williams.

Also, their batsmen managed to score 147 runs. Sean Williams, from the team managed to score 64 runs on 42 balls, with the help of eight boundaries. Ryan Burl was the other batter, who faced around 25 balls and smashed two boundaries and one huge six during his inning. Along with them, Regis Chakabva also scored 15 runs.

Team of Netherlands

The Netherlands team, on the other hand, couldn’t register a single victory for their team in the Super 12 rounds. Not long ago, the team was defeated by Pakistan with a margin of around six wickets. According to reports, their batting unit did try to set a tough competition for their competitors, but they could score only 91 runs in 20 overs. Among their batsmen, Colin Ackermann managed to score the maximum runs, with 27 runs to his name in 27 deliveries, with the help of two boundaries. And the skipper, Scott Edwards scored 15 runs

Moreover, the bowlers also struggled to show their excellent form. It was Brandon Glover from their side, who picked two wickets in 2.5 overs against 22 runs. Paul van Meekeren was the other bowler who picked up one wicket in four overs against 19 runs.

Predicted Speculations

As per previous records, Zimbabwe won three matches against Netherlands. But the Netherlands team could register only one win against the team of Zimbabwe.

Based on recent performances and past records, Zimbabwe seems to be stronger than the Netherlands. Perhaps, the chance of winning the upcoming match is more in favour of Zimbabwe. Moreover, Zimbabwe’s performance has been better in the tournament compared to their next competitor. 

But players of Netherlands are equally expected to come up with their previous form that were showcased by them in the qualifier battles.
